What does code P2114 mean?

A P2114 trouble code indicates that the throttle or accelerator pedal position sensor β€œB” is not performing within its expected range, especially at its minimum (closed) position.

This means the PCM is detecting inconsistent or incorrect readings from the sensor, which can affect how the throttle responds and how the engine idles.

Common symptoms of a P2114 code

  • Rough or unstable idle
  • Poor throttle response
  • Reduced engine power
  • Vehicle may enter limp mode
  • Check engine light on
  • Hesitation during acceleration
  • Inconsistent throttle behavior

What can cause a P2114 code?

  • Faulty throttle position sensor (Sensor B)
  • Accelerator pedal position sensor issues
  • Dirty or sticking throttle body
  • Carbon buildup affecting throttle plate movement
  • Wiring or connector problems
  • Sensor calibration issues
  • PCM-related performance faults

This code is typically related to sensor accuracy and performance issues.


Is P2114 serious?

It can be. While the vehicle may still run, inconsistent throttle readings can lead to drivability issues and unreliable performance.

If not addressed, it may cause further throttle system problems.


How is P2114 diagnosed?

  • Scan for additional trouble codes
  • Inspect throttle body for buildup
  • Check throttle plate movement
  • Test throttle and pedal position sensors
  • Inspect wiring and connectors
  • Verify PCM inputs and outputs

Accurate diagnosis is important since this involves sensor comparison and performance.


How do you fix a P2114 code?

  • Clean the throttle body
  • Repair or replace faulty sensors
  • Fix wiring or connector issues
  • Perform throttle relearn procedures
  • Address airflow-related problems
  • Test and repair PCM-related issues if needed

Many cases are resolved with cleaning and recalibration.


Can a bad PCM cause a P2114 code?

Yes, although it is less common. The PCM monitors and compares sensor data. If it cannot properly interpret or process signals, it may trigger a P2114 code.
